When is the best time to book a Bed & Breakfast in Woodstock?
The best time to book a B&B in Woodstock is during the vibrant summer months from June to September, when the area comes alive with festivals, music, and outdoor activities. This peak season offers a wonderful opportunity for travelers to immerse themselves in the artistic and cultural pulse of the town, all while enjoying the warm, pleasant weather. Temperatures generally range from the mid-60s to the mid-80s Fahrenheit, making it ideal for outdoor exploration and leisurely strolls through the picturesque streets.

July stands out as the most popular month, attracting visitors eager to participate in local events and enjoy the scenic beauty of the surrounding Catskill Mountains. The lively atmosphere, coupled with various arts and crafts fairs, creates a great blend of excitement and relaxation. From hiking to live music performances, there's something for everyone to enjoy during this bustling time.

For those looking for a more budget-friendly experience, consider planning your visit in December. While this month is less crowded, it brings its own charm with festive decorations and holiday events that showcase the town's unique character. Visitors can take advantage of the cozy ambiance and explore local shops, making it a delightful time to experience Woodstock's warmth without the summer rush.
